Vancouver Island is a tranquil summer sanctuary off Canada’s West Coast and the largest island on North America’s Pacific Coast. The beautiful island prides itself on a balmy coastal climate, a thriving arts community, and charming towns.

Start your exploration in Victoria, the capital of British Columbia, which oozes a unique Victorian character and natural grandeur. If you have a penchant for surfing, brave the tides in Tofino: one of Canada’s popular surf destinations.
